Mukherjee to inaugurate 'Festival of Innovations' on Saturday


Posted on 4th Mar 2015 12:48 pm by mohit kumar

New Delhi, March 3 (IANS) President Pranab Mukherjee will inaugurate a week-long 'Festival of Innovations' at Rashtrapati Bhavan here on Saturday.

The festival is being organised by the president's secretariat in collaboration with the National Innovation Foundation, a release said.

On the first day of the festival, Mukherjee will give away national biennial awards for grassroots innovations.

The president will also interact with a new batch of innovation scholars in-residence and writers in-residence, it said.

To coincide with the festival, in-residence programmes for innovation scholars and writers will also be organised from March 7 to 21.

Other events, which are part of the festival include a global round table on inclusive innovation which aims at developing a universal, open, reciprocal and responsive innovation platform through sharing of strategies used by different countries.
